EP secondary directorship LOC: primary-employer consent pack
Companion to EP / incorporation — when a board seat at a related company needs MOM Letter of Consent, ACRA relatedness checks, primary-employer written consent, and why shareholding alone is not moonlighting clearance.
Parents: Employment Pass · incorporating as a foreigner. Founder fork: EntrePass vs resident director. This companion is the EP employee board-seat layer Reddit collapses into “I’ll just add myself as director of the side Pte Ltd.”
LOC is the product — not the ACRA filing
MOM’s secondary-directorship path is for appointing an EP holder from a related company onto another company’s board — with the primary employer’s consent and a Letter of Consent. ACRA registration alone does not authorise you to work that second entity.
| Folklore | Safer reading |
|---|---|
| “Shareholder = I can direct the co” | Shareholding ≠ work authorisation on EP |
| “Unpaid advisory is always fine” | Unpaid charity boards are a different FAQ; paid commercial seats need the LOC path |
| “Related means same industry WhatsApp” | Relatedness must show in ACRA shareholding / group records MOM can verify |
| “HR nodded on Slack” | Keep written primary-employer consent for the LOC file |
Consent pack before you accept the seat
- Confirm the appointing company is related on ACRA (group / shareholding), not a friend’s startup.
- Get primary employer consent in writing (who, role, paid/unpaid, meeting load).
- File / hold the LOC before you act as director in Singapore.
- Track LOC validity against the underlying EP — EP cancel kills the LOC story.
- Do not invoice Singapore clients through the side co as “director fees” without checking side income.
Decision rule
Primary EP + related ACRA entity + written consent + LOC — miss any one and treat the board seat as blocked, not “pending paperwork vibes.”
